Support for transportation expenses is an ongoing challenge for Advantage Behavioral Health Systems’ various programs. Transportation is an essential ingredient for serving people who are creating better lives through real personal accomplishment.
We have made major strides in supporting transit at Advantage over the last two years. Friends was awarded a grant from the Athens Area Community Foundation in its first grant cycle to purchase bus passes for clients in Clarke County.
Several generous donors, including the St. Mary's Hospital Foundation, Jackson EMC Trust, and Frances Hollis Brain Foundation made it possible for Jackson Creative to convert a hospital ambulance into a lift van for its program participants who are wheelchair-bound.
However, we continue to pursue funding to meet these needs in new ways. Our goal for this year is to build support for a Child & Adolescent Travel Fund.
